Summary

The Machine Operator Level A is responsible for conducting set‑ups and change overs, operating various types of machinery to produce parts within dimensional tolerances, using select feeds and speeds based on alloy type to obtain the optimal cutting conditions and producing the longest tool life.

Duties and Responsibilities

To perform this job successfully an individual must be able to perform the following essential duties satisfactorily. Other duties may be assigned to address business needs and changing business practices.

  • Follows all EHS rules and regulations.
  • Produces parts according to print requirements, and produces tooling, fixtures or other parts using various types of machinery.
  • Measures part dimensions using calipers, micrometers, or other types of measurement equipment ensuring parts are within Greenbrier Rail Services and Association of American Railroads specifications.
  • Maintains tools and equipment in good, clean working order to maximize tool life.
  • Performs safety checks on every machine, keeping work area clean and orderly.
  • Monitors machines during every procedure to ensure machine optimization.
  • Participates in mentoring others on the processes and procedures within the Machine Operator family of positions.
  • Other duties as assigned, including but not limited to special processes.
